Use a longer strap if possible. If not possible, I'd say use a shackle.
A shackle is more secure than a dowel will ever be, and tying two straps together at the loops does nothing but create a weak point. Where as a shackle doesn't remove strength from the strap so long as it's the proper duty rating.
